The murder of Kelly Ann Tinyes /TIN-uhs/ occurred on March 3, 1989. [ 1] Tinyes was a thirteen-year-old Valley Stream, New York resident who was strangled, stabbed, and mutilated. [ 2] Her body was discovered in the basement of her neighbor, twenty-one-year-old bodybuilder Robert Golub, who was charged with and convicted of her murder. [ 3]

Larry DeWayne Hall (born December 11, 1962) is an American kidnapper, rapist, murderer, and suspected serial killer. An aficionado of the American Revolution and Civil War, Hall traveled around the Midwest for historical reenactments and is believed to have abducted, raped, tortured, and murdered dozens of girls and women.
